POSITION SUMMARY
Responsible for ensuring timely delivery and accurate replenishment of raw material through effective supply chain and procurement planning. Supports inventory management for all Canadian plants and warehouses, leveraging SAP ERP for planning and data accuracy. Drives continuous improvement and cost-saving initiatives across procurement and supply chain processes.
M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ES
Material Planning & Replenishment Responsibilities
- Run MRP for assigned raw material portfolio and execute replenishment plans accordingly.
- Analyse production schedules and demand forecasts to determine material requirements.
- Generate and manage purchase orders to ensure on-time material availability.
- Monitor and follow up on open orders and expected deliveries to prevent shortages or delays.
- Align planning activities with inventory optimization strategies and excess inventory reduction plans.
- Collaborate with key functions (Operations, R&D, QC, Production) to improve processes and harmonize planning across plants.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ives and participate in S&OP and sustainability projects.
Inventory Management Responsibilities
- Develop, maintain, and monitor optimal inventory levels to avoid stockouts and excess inventory.
- Analyze usage trends, lead times, and consumption patterns to recommend the most effective replenishment strategy.
